From owner-freebsd-hackers Tue Nov 4 16:42:11 1997 Return-Path: Received: (from root@localhost) by hub.freebsd.org (8.8.7/8.8.7) id QAA22811 for hackers-outgoing; Tue, 4 Nov 1997 16:42:11 -0800 (PST) (envelope-from owner-freebsd-hackers) Received: from roguetrader.com (brandon@cold.org [206.81.134.103]) by hub.freebsd.org (8.8.7/8.8.7) with ESMTP id QAA22805 for ; Tue, 4 Nov 1997 16:42:07 -0800 (PST) (envelope-from brandon@roguetrader.com) Received: from localhost (brandon@localhost) by roguetrader.com (8.8.5/8.8.5) with SMTP id RAA01604; Tue, 4 Nov 1997 17:41:43 -0700 (MST) Date: Tue, 4 Nov 1997 17:41:43 -0700 (MST) From: Brandon Gillespie To: "Jordan K. Hubbard" cc: Marc Slemko , hackers@FreeBSD.ORG Subject: Re: mv /usr/src/games /dev/null - any objections? In-Reply-To: <12273.878682976@time.cdrom.com> Message-ID: MIME-Version: 1.0 Content-Type: TEXT/PLAIN; charset=US-ASCII Sender: owner-freebsd-hackers@FreeBSD.ORG X-Loop: FreeBSD.org Precedence: bulk On Tue, 4 Nov 1997, Jordan K. Hubbard wrote: > > So, to seperate out the issues here, first form a list of everything that > > should be around but not in /usr/games because it isn't. Then propose > > moving those to usr.bin or wherever is appropriate for the particular > > program. > > > > After that, propose nuking what is left of /usr/games in favor of a port > > or whatever. > > I think that pretty much sums it up, yes. My suggestions, based off /usr/games from 2.2.5-R Sub packages: bsdmisc -- somewhat useful tools/toys/misc programs bsdgames -- general bsd style games bsdadventure -- bsd text adventure games bsdlegacy -- bsd 'not really games, rather useless programs now' Perhaps splitup 'bsdgames' a little more, based off general types.. *shrug* Note the keyword 'like' we should use when referring to games of TM nature. When 'mv ??' is seen, I'm not sure if we should change its name or not (is it copyright?), and if so, to what name? Game/CMD PKG Action Description -------- --- ------ ----------- adventure bsdadventure text adventure arithmetic bsdlegacy asks math questions, you answer atc bsdgames air traffic controller backgammon bsdgames mv ?? like backgammon teachgammon bsdgames teach the rules to backgammon battlestar bsdadventure mv ?? text adventure bcd bsdlegacy input text, output like punch cards boggle bsdgames mv duh like boggle bs bsdgames like battleship caesar bsdmisc decrypt caesar ciphers canfield bsdgames solitare game cfscores bsdgames part of canfield cribbage bsdgames dm bsdgames mv gm game master (dungeon master is a tm of TSR) wraps games.. perhaps just rm? factor bsdmisc factor a number fish bsdgames play 'fish' fortune bsdmisc grdc bsdlegacy curses based digital clock hack bsdadventure explore the Dungeons of Doom, like rogue hangman bsdgames mv ?? play hangman larn bsdadventure mv ?? explore the caverns of Larn mille bsdgames mv ?? play Mille Bornes morse bsdlegacy input text, output morse code number bsdmisc numbers as english (i.e. one hundred) phantasia bsdgames mv ?? an interterminal fantasy game piano bsdlegacy mv ?? play a piano using QWERTYUIOP[] pig bsdgames input text, output piglatin pom bsdmisc display the phase of the moon ppt bsdlegacy input text, output paper tape primes bsdmisc figure prime numbers quiz bsdgames random knowledge tests rain bsdlegacy display ascii rain on your terminal random bsdmisc pick random lines from file robots bsdgames fight off villainous robots rogue bsdadventure explore the Dungeons of Doom rot13 bsdmisc input text, output text+13 sail bsdgames multi-user sailing of ships snake bsdgames evade snakes snscore bsdgames part of snake strfile bsdgames? used by several programs to create unstr ''string'' file databases trek bsdgames mv ?? trekkie game wargames bsdgames stupid front end to games worm bsdgames growing worm game worms bsdlegacy animated ascii worms wump bsdgames hunt the wumpus in an underground cave